Welcome to the QI Guy in conversation...podcast. In this episode, I'm conversing with Paul Bowie from NHS Education for Scotland. Paul is a Chartered Ergonomist and Human Factors specialist, safety scientist, and medical educator with NHS Education for Scotland based in Glasgow, where he is Programme Director (Safety & Improvement) and Director of the Safety, Skills and Improvement Research Collaborative (SKIRC). He has worked in the National Health Service in Scotland for over 25 years in a range of quality and safety advisory roles.
